
Bulgaria announced three finalists at the European Men’s Under-22 Boxing Championship in Budva. Ergunal Sebakhtin (48 kg), Yasen Radev (54 kg) and Radoslav Rosenov (60 kg) will box for the gold medals on Sunday in the ring in Montenegro.
Sebakhtin defeated Mihai Porombak (Moldova) by knockout in the third round and will meet Musheg Bayanduryan (Russia) for the gold.
Radev managed a 5-0 vote against the representative of Kosovo Bashkim Bayoku and on Sunday he will box with Andrey Peglivanyan (Russia).
Rosenov, for his part, beat the local talent Tomislav Djinovich 4:1 and will compete with Konstantin Opolsky (Russia).
Bad luck befell our last representative in the semi-finals today, William Cholov, who had to settle for the bronze medal in the 75 kg category because of an arcade. Our national player was hit in the head by the Russian Cherav Ashalaev at the end of the first round, and because of the wound, the Bulgarian could not continue, and the referees named his opponent as the winner.
